Ingredients
To prepare these vibrant Mediterranean Bowls, gather the following ingredients:
Base Ingredients:
- 1 cup of quinoa (or brown rice for a variation)
- 2 cups of vegetable broth (or water for cooking)
Protein Choices:
- 1 can of chickpeas (drained and rinsed)
- 1 cup of grilled chicken (or tofu for a vegetarian option)
Fresh Veggies:
- 1 cup of cherry tomatoes (halved)
- 1 cucumber (diced)
- 1 bell pepper (diced)
- 1/2 red onion (finely chopped)
- 1/2 cup of Kalamata olives (sliced)
Toppings:
- 1/4 cup of feta cheese (crumbled)
- Fresh parsley (chopped, for garnish)
- Olive oil (for drizzling)
- Lemon juice (to taste)
- Salt and pepper (to taste)
Instructions
Now that we have our ingredients ready, let’s dive into how to make these mouthwatering Mediterranean Bowls!
Step 1: Cook the Quinoa
- Rinse the quinoa under cold water. Combine it with the vegetable broth in a saucepan.
-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low and cover. Let it simmer for about 15 minutes or until all the liquid is absorbed. Fluff with a fork and set aside.
Step 2: Prep the Protein
- For chickpeas: In a skillet over medium heat, sauté with olive oil, salt, and pepper for about 5 minutes until they are golden and crispy.
- For grilled chicken: Season with your favorite spices, grill or sauté until cooked through, then slice it into strips.
Step 3: Assemble the Bowls
- Divide the cooked quinoa among bowls, creating a bed for the toppings.
- Layer on the chickpeas or chicken, followed by the cherry tomatoes, cucumber, bell pepper, red onion, and olives.
Step 4: Dress It Up!
- Drizzle olive oil and lemon juice over the bowls.
- Sprinkle feta cheese and fresh parsley on top.
- Season with salt and pepper to taste.

Tips & Variations
- Customize Your Protein: Swap chickpeas for lentils for a different texture or use shrimp for a seafood twist.
- Add Greens: Incorporate a handful of spinach or arugula for added nutrients and flavor.
- Explore Flavors: Experiment with different dressings, like tahini or a spicy harissa, to keep things exciting.
- Meal Prep-Friendly: These bowls store well in the fridge for up to 3 days—perfect for quick lunches throughout the week!
